Abstract
A new method to work out the Hermitian correspondence of a PT-symmetric quantum mechanical Hamiltonian is proposed. In contrast to the conventional method, the new method ends with a local Hamiltonian of the form p^2/2+m^2x^2/2+v(x) without any higher-derivative terms. This method is demonstrated in the perturbative regime. Possible extensions to multi-variable quantum mechanics and quantum field theories are discussed.
